Bluetooth operation
Pairing Bluetooth-enabled devices
First time you connect your Bluetooth device to
this sound bar, you need to pair your device to
this sound bar.
Notes:
The operation range between this sound bar
and a Bluetooth device is approximately 10 me-
ters (without any object between the Bluetooth
device and the sound bar).
Before you connect a Bluetooth device to this
sound bar, ensure you know the device’s capa-
bilities.
Compatibility with all Bluetooth devices is not
guaranteed.
Any obstacle between this sound bar and a
Bluetooth device can reduce the operation
range.
If the signal strength is weak, your Bluetooth re-
ceiver may disconnect, but it will re-enter pair-
ing mode automatically.
Bluetooth pairing from your device to this unit
can be done during stand by and power on
mode at all functions. However, Bluetooth play-
back from the source device is applicable at
Bluetooth function only.
1. While in power on mode, press the button
on the sound bar or remote control repeated-
ly to select Bluetooth mode. The blue indica-
tor will be blinking.
2. Activate your Bluetooth device and select the
search mode. “HT-SBW125 SHARP” will ap-
pear on your Bluetooth device list.
If you cannot find the sound bar, press the
button on the sound bar or remote control to
be searchable. The blue indicator will blink
rapidly.
3. Select “HT-SBW125 SHARP” in the pairing
list. The system is successfully connected
when the blue indicator lights up.
4. Begin playing music from the connected
Bluetooth device.
To disconnect the Bluetooth function, you can:
Switch to another function on the sound bar.
Disable the Bluetooth function on your device.
The device is successfully disconnected from
the sound bar when the blue indicator blinks
rapidly.
Press the button on the sound bar or remote
control.
Notes:
Enter “0000” for the password if necessary.
If no other Bluetooth device pairs with this
sound bar in 2 minutes, the sound bar will re-
connect to the previous connection.
The sound bar will also be disconnected when
your device is moved beyond the operational
range.
If you want to reconnect your device to this
sound bar, place it within the operational range.
If the device is moved beyond the operational
range, when it is brought back, please check if
the device is still connected to the sound bar.
If the connection is lost, follow the instructions
above to pair your device to the sound bar
again.
Listen to music from Bluetooth device
If the connected Bluetooth device supports Ad-
vanced Audio Distribution pro file (A2DP), you
can listen to the music stored on the device
through the sound bar.
If the device also supports Audio Video Remote
Control Pro file (AVRCP), you can use the sound
bar’s remote control to play music stored on the
device.
1. Pair your device with the sound bar.
2. Play music via your device (if it supports
A2DP).
3. Use supplied remote control to control play
(if it supports AVRCP).
To pause or resume play, press the but-
ton on the sound bar or remote control.
To skip to a track, press the or but-
tons on the remote control.
